Window Security Fixtures

The DX trellis range built to window openings: single steel bars and high-security flights, in four models, for windows that still need to open.

Window security fixtures are the DEFENDoor® DX range, but built to a window opening rather than a doorway. They come in four models, the DX-222, DX-420, DX-310, and DX-215, each made from single steel bars fitted with high-security flights, with stainless steel rivets at every essential joint so the fixture does not corrode from the inside out.

The reason to choose a fixture over fixed bars is that the window still works. Bars embedded in the brickwork secure an opening permanently, while a DX fixture secures it and still lets you clear the opening when you want it clear.

These are the same four models as our trellis security gates, built to a different opening. That means the same single steel bars with no seam at a join, the same high-security flights, and the same stainless rivets. The trellis gates page carries the full model-by-model breakdown if you want to compare flight counts and upright gauges before choosing.

The finish is powder-coated and can be colour matched to your existing window frames, so a fixture blends in with the frames it is fitted against.

What you get

  • Single steel bars

    One continuous bar per upright rather than two bars joined along their length, so there is no seam for a crowbar to separate. It is the same principle the trellis gates are built on.

  • High-security flights

    The flights are what stand between an intruder and the opening, and they are riveted rather than bolted. How many flights a fixture carries depends on which of the four models you choose.

  • Stainless steel rivets

    All essential rivets are stainless steel, so the joints holding the flights together resist corrosion and do not fail years before the steel around them does.

  • The window still opens

    A fixture leaves you able to clear the opening, which is what you want on a window used for ventilation, for access, or as an escape route. That is what sets it apart from bars embedded in the brickwork.

  • Four models to choose from

    The range runs from the entry-level DX-215 up to the DX-222, with the DX-420 and DX-310 between them. Which one suits an opening depends on the window and the level of protection you want.

Frequently asked questions

What is a window security fixture?
A window security fixture is the DEFENDoor® DX range built to a window opening rather than a doorway, made from single steel bars with high-security flights, in four models. Unlike burglar bars embedded in the brickwork, a fixture leaves you able to clear the opening when you want it clear.
How is this different from burglar bars?
Burglar bars are embedded into the wall and secure the window permanently, while a fixture secures the opening and still lets it be cleared. That is what you want on a window used for ventilation, for access, or as an escape route. Fixed bars are a streamlined, affordable answer when a window does not need to open fully.
Are these the same as your trellis security gates?
Window fixtures use the same four models and the same construction as our trellis gates, single steel bars, high-security flights, and stainless steel rivets, built to a window opening instead of a doorway. The trellis security gates page carries the full model-by-model breakdown, including flight counts and upright gauges.
Which model should I choose?
The DX-222 sits at the top of the range and the DX-215 is the entry-level model, with the DX-420 and DX-310 between them. What separates them is how much steel stands between an intruder and the opening. Our consultants will talk it through at the free assessment with a sample to hand.
Why are the rivets stainless steel?
The rivets hold the flights together, and a corroded rivet can undo a fixture long before the steel around it gives way. Using stainless steel throughout means the joints last as long as the rest of the fixture, which counts for most in coastal and humid areas.
